Conservation Department to host cable restraint seminar
The Missouri Department of Conservation will be conducting a free cable restraint device training seminar for interested trappers at the Four Rivers Conservation Area headquarters building on Sunday, Jan. 16. The seminar will begin at 1:30 and last for approximately four hours, according to Vernon County Conservation Agent Shawn Pennington.
The course for using cable restraint devices, or snares as they are commonly called, will be divided between classroom instruction on the rules restrictions and regulations governing the use of the traps and hands on activities. Participants will learn things like how to properly set the traps and what sign to look for when scouting. The course is mandatory for anyone wishing to use the device for trapping furbearers in Missouri. There is no registration required.
